I don't know if you found your answer yet, but I still work with 3.4x and have 
found that the build in encryption works just fine if you do this.
 
to enter in the first place, let the user type in his password, encrypt and 
save.
 
Whenever the user must use the password, have them type it in, encrypt it again 
and see if the encryption matches the saved one.  If so, bob's your uncle.  do 
this way because there is no decryption routine.
